Key Points:

Panama's Minister of Environment, Juan Carlos Navarro, expressed his satisfaction that a mining project in Donoso is currently not operational. He affirmed his well-known anti-mining stance. An environmental audit of the project is underway, with the Ministry of Commerce and Industries responsible for releasing results and determining future steps. The minister emphasized that there are currently no updates regarding the mine.

Environmental Focus:

Navarro's main focus is the environmental recovery plan for the Darién rainforest, impacted by irregular migration. He anticipates collaboration with the new US ambassador to advance this project.

Sustainable Tourism:

The Ministry of Environment is actively promoting sustainable tourism to attract environmentally conscious visitors and investments.
